The US Lacrosse number is very important and necessary to register your player. This is a yearly US Lacrosse membership which provides secondary insurance for players, teams, and leagues to eliminate potential worries associated with lacrosse participation. All lacrosse players need one in order to play with 405 LAX, and it is also required for any other lacrosse opportunities you would be looking to explore. We utilize volunteer coaches to lead each team. As we are experiencing rapid growth of the sport in our area, we need more volunteers to provide a quality experience for each child. Coaches will undergo a background check and training from US Lacrosse to ensure players enjoy the sport in an environment that encourages both high challenge and high support. Coaches will also have the opportunity to attend Coaches Clinics hosted by 405's high school coaching staff to educate them on proper technique, rules of the game, and game strategy.
